TMC MP Kalyan Banerjee has stepped down from his role as chief whip in the Lok Sabha, citing internal discord as a trigger for his decision.

The announcement came during a virtual meeting chaired by party chief Mamata Banerjee, where concerns over inter-MP coordination were discussed.

Known for his legal acumen and a four-time MP from Sreerampur, Banerjee's frequent clashes with colleagues, including Mahua Moitra, have put the party's internal dynamics in the spotlight.
